Step 1: Understand What Makes Your Legendary Gear Special
Before you dive headfirst into a new build, pause for a sec. You need to know what you’re working with. Legendary items are legendary for a reason—they’re loaded with unique stats, bonuses, or abilities that can shift the tide of battle.Break Down Its Stats
Pull up that gear and read every single word in the description. What stats does it boost? Strength? Agility? Magic power? Sometimes the most important details are tucked away in the fine print. Missing a critical perk could mean missing out on a whole new playstyle.For example, if you have a legendary bow that increases critical hit chance by 50%, you’ll want to focus on skills and attributes that maximize crit damage. On the other hand, if your gear boosts elemental resistance, maybe you pivot toward survivability.
Check Out Unique Abilities
Does your equipment have a passive ability or a game-changing active skill? These unique features often hold the key to building an optimized character. For instance, a legendary staff with an "infinite mana" effect will completely change how you approach combat—suddenly, that skill you avoided because it was a mana hog might become your bread and butter.

Step 3: Align Your Skills and Attributes
Alright, now that you’ve studied your gear and pinned down your playstyle, it’s time to tweak those skills and attributes so everything meshes perfectly. Building a character around legendary equipment essentially means reverse-engineering your setup.Re-Spec When Necessary
Most games let you redistribute skill points, attributes, or perks. This is your opportunity to laser-focus your character toward making the most of your legendary item. Boost whichever stats directly enhance the gear’s strengths—whether that’s strength, intelligence, vitality, or something else.Prioritize Synergy
The goal here is synergy! If your legendary armor boosts dodge rate, start stacking agility or mobility stats. Meanwhile, a legendary sword with fire damage? Find skills that complement elemental attacks to maximize the pain you dish out.Pro Tip: Some items thrive on niche abilities. Have you ever ignored a skill tree just because it seemed irrelevant? Take a second look—your legendary gear might breathe new life into those forgotten talents.
Step 4: Gear Synergy is Key
It’s not just about your one legendary item; it’s about the whole ensemble. Think of your character like a band, and that legendary equipment is the rockstar lead singer. Sure, they’re the centerpiece, but they’ll sound way better when the drummer, guitarist, and bassist (your other gear) are killing it, too.Match Your Gear Attributes
When choosing supporting gear, make sure it complements your legendary item. If your legendary chest plate is focused on boosting health regeneration, look for boots or gloves that increase total health or reduce cooldowns for healing abilities.Combo Your Effects
Some games take it even further by giving set bonuses when you pair the right items together. This is like the ultimate duet for your legendary and supporting gear—an extra layer of synergy that makes everything feel like it belongs together.Step 5: Test, Adapt, Refine

Pay Attention to Weaknesses
Sometimes, building around legendary equipment can create unintended weaknesses. Does your character suddenly feel like a glass cannon? Maybe you’ve sacrificed too much defense for attack power. Or are you struggling to keep up with teammates because your build lacks mobility? Don’t be afraid to adjust.What If You Don’t Like Your Legendary Gear?
It happens. Maybe you got an incredible drop that everyone else in your party envies, but it just doesn’t fit your style. Don’t force it. A mismatched legendary item can be more of a burden than a blessing, no matter how powerful it is.Here’s an alternative: stash it. You never know when inspiration might strike, or when another piece of gear comes along that completes the puzzle. Or if trading is an option in your game, consider finding someone who can actually use it. Karma points, right?
